This place had a lot of good vegan options. The food came out fairly quickly. I appreciated the pancakes and the Caesar salad and I would rate those as a 5 out of five. We also got a crepe that was just okay. Maybe it was just the one that we ordered but I wasn’t wild about it. On the other hand my wife seemed to really like it. The Smoothie was fantastic and all organic so definitely something you should get and overall I think a place we would certainly frequent if we were locals. If you’re in the area and you’re looking for some vegan Chow you should check this place out

Lovely spot to grab breakfast/brunch in my opinion. There are both sweet and savory crepes to choose from, as well as other foods, but I suggest the crepes mostly. The service is always good and the atmosphere is quiet and serene. A great place to do some computer work as one would do in a Starbucks perhaps. There are art pieces displayed along the walls that are available for purchase, all you need to do is find one you like and use Venmo to pay the artist. In my most recent visit with my family, we ended up walking out with a nice punting of some trees surrounding a river in Niagara Falls. The artist was in the restaurant at the time and we had a nice talk with him. I would highly suggest coming here if you’re looking for a good place to eat or relax with a drink.
